Question 1: Heat recovery ventilators (HRVs) contribute to furnace system efficiency in tight, well-insulated homes by:
- Reducing the furnace's gas input rate
- Increasing the AFUE rating stamped on the furnace nameplate
- Transferring heat from outgoing stale air to incoming fresh air, reducing ventilation heating losses (Correct answer)
- Replacing the need for a furnace in mild climates
Correct answer: Transferring heat from outgoing stale air to incoming fresh air, reducing ventilation heating losses
HRVs pre-condition incoming fresh air using the energy in exhaust air, recovering 70–85% of the heat that would otherwise be lost during ventilation.
Question 2: What does a rollout switch (also called a flame rollout limit) protect against?
- Excessive blower motor current draw
- Excessive return air temperature
- Flames escaping outside the burner box due to blocked heat exchanger or flue (Correct answer)
- Overpressure in the gas supply line
Correct answer: Flames escaping outside the burner box due to blocked heat exchanger or flue
A rollout switch detects flames rolling out of the burner compartment, which indicates a blocked heat exchanger or venting problem, and shuts down the furnace.

Question 7: What is the purpose of the dielectric union required when connecting a gas furnace to the gas supply piping that contains dissimilar metals?
- To provide a shutoff point for servicing
- To prevent galvanic corrosion between dissimilar metals (Correct answer)
- To reduce gas pressure at the appliance connection
- To allow for thermal expansion of the piping
Correct answer: To prevent galvanic corrosion between dissimilar metals
Dielectric unions electrically isolate dissimilar metals in piping to prevent galvanic corrosion that could deteriorate connections.

Question 14: A technician measures manifold gas pressure on a natural gas furnace and finds it is 2.0 in. W.C. The manufacturer specifies 3.5 in. W.C. What symptom would this cause?
- Burner over-fire and overheating
- Weak flames, insufficient heat output, and possible pilot or ignition failure (Correct answer)
- Elevated carbon monoxide production
- Pressure switch nuisance trips
Correct answer: Weak flames, insufficient heat output, and possible pilot or ignition failure
Low manifold pressure produces weak flames that may not sustain ignition, resulting in reduced heat output and potential ignition lockouts.

Question 20: A technician discovers that the induced-draft motor on a furnace is drawing 20% more current than the nameplate rating. What is the MOST likely cause?
- Faulty thermostat anticipator
- Undersized supply voltage
- Oversize gas supply pressure
- Bearing wear or partial blockage in the venting system causing the motor to work harder (Correct answer)
Correct answer: Bearing wear or partial blockage in the venting system causing the motor to work harder
Worn bearings or a venting restriction increases load on the inducer motor, causing it to draw more current than its rated amperage.

Question 27: When converting a furnace from natural gas to propane (LP), what must be replaced?
- The heat exchanger
- The blower motor
- The orifice spud and pressure regulator spring (Correct answer)
- The thermocouple
Correct answer: The orifice spud and pressure regulator spring
Propane has higher BTU content and different pressure requirements, so orifices must be downsized and the regulator spring changed.

Question 29: Which condition most commonly causes a furnace burner to produce a lifting or floating flame?
- Cracked heat exchanger
- Faulty thermocouple
- Too little gas pressure
- Excess primary air at the burner (Correct answer)
Correct answer: Excess primary air at the burner
Excess primary air causes the flame to lift off the burner ports because the mixture velocity exceeds the flame propagation speed.
